WebPassive vocabulary adds to the words of our active vocabulary many others stored in the depth of our memory. They could hardly be retrieved without external impact. The role of such impact plays written or voiced text. We recognize words and understand (or sometimes guess) their meaning within phrases and sentences while listening or reading.

WebIntermediate 3,000 words. Vocabulary of 3,000 words will help you express your thoughts, needs and will enable you to lead a simple conversation. 3,000 English words is enough to provide coverage for common everyday use (news, daily conversations).
